		<description>Like eyeballkid suggested, I&apos;ve been using inline css to make the occasional button more or less like the ones discussed here.

An example :

[span style=&quot;font-family: verdana, sans-serif;
font-size: 10px;
font-weight:bold;
text-decoration:none;
color: white;
background-color: #000099;
border-left:1px solid #0066cc;
border-top:1px solid #0066cc;
border-right:1px solid #000066;
border-bottom:1px solid #000066;
padding:0px 3px 0px 3px;
margin:0px;&quot;]
Blah!
[/span]

Share and enjoy.</description>

		<description>While I agree completely that body type on most &quot;hip&quot; websites is too small, I don&apos;t think that complaint has relevance in this context. Eight point Silkscreen is a good choice for these badges, which are really meant to be recognized rather than read. Kottke designed Silkscreen to be used &quot;in places where extremely small graphical display type is needed&quot;:&lt;blockquote&gt;&quot;The primary use is for navigational items (nav bars, menus, etc.).&quot;
&#160;
&quot;In order to preserve the proper spacing and letterforms, Silkscreen should be used at 8pt. multiples (8pt., 16pt., 24pt., etc.) with anti-aliasing turned off.&quot;&lt;/blockquote&gt;</description>
